A dermoscopy case series of cutaneous metastases from breast cancer in Filipino females

open access: yesJEADV Clinical Practice, Volume 3, Issue 5, Page 1631-1637, December 2024.
Capsule Summary Three cases of cutaneous metastases in Filipino females with breast cancer presented with round, firm, nontender, erythematous nodules on the trunk. Dermoscopic findings noted were linear, irregular, arborizing and polymorphic vessels, bright white lines at the periphery and white areas, homogenous yellow to yellow‐orange structureless ...

Descartes on Place and Motion: A Reading through Cartesian Commentaries**

open access: yesBerichte zur Wissenschaftsgeschichte, Volume 47, Issue 3, Page 179-214, September 2024.
Abstract This paper offers a reconstruction of the interpretations of Descartes's ideas of place and motion by Dutch Cartesians (Henricus Regius, Johannes de Raey, Johannes Clauberg, and Christoph Wittich). It does so by focusing on the reading of Descartes's Principia philosophiae (1644) offered, in particular, by the dictated commentaries on it.
